On The Hook with Matt Wilson

On The Hook with Matt Wilson

Author, songwriter, musician, and performer Matt Wilson explores topics covered in his book Hooks: Lessons on Performance, Business, and Life from a Working Musician. Guests from all walks of life share personal and professional experiences on performance, confidence, courage & fear, perspective, creativity, expectations, management, and skills.
